Okay, the 1860 census says this:

Blenheim, Scholarie Co., New York:

Daniel Sage, 42, coooper, b NY

Catherine, 36?, b NY

Louanna, 10, b NY

Mary, 7, b NY <-- right age to be Mary, 27 of 1880 census

Delphene, 3, enumerated as male, b NY

Henry W., 1, b NY <-- I love that the middle initial helps us tie him to the Henry without a middle initial in 1880 and therefore later Henry W. Sages...

Going back to the 1880 census, I mentioned that the image was difficult to read. I'm now looking at the enlarged image of it, and I think Ancestry.com mis-indexed Henry's parents' names. "Carrine" is definitely Catherine when you look at the image, and "David"'s name is VERY light, and could very well be Daniel.

So I think we can now safely say that Henry W. Sage's parents were Daniel Sage and Catherine _____.
